Comprehending Car Keys: Types and Technology
Before diving into the look for replacement keys, it's essential to understand the numerous types of car keys and the technology behind them. Modern automobiles make use of numerous types of keys, and determining your key type can enhance the replacement process.
Types of Car Keys
Conventional Car Keys
These are basic metal keys that merely turn the ignition. They are easy to replicate at any locksmith or hardware store.
Transponder Keys
These keys have a chip ingrained within them, which interacts with the vehicle's ignition system. If the key is not acknowledged, the car will not begin. Replacement keys for transponder designs often require programming, which can only be done by a professional or customized locksmith.
Remote Key Fobs
Remote key fobs often include physical keys also. They allow chauffeurs to open doors from another location and often start the engine. Replacement key fobs generally require to be programmed to the specific vehicle.
Smart Keys
These innovative systems allow for keyless entry and ignition. In the occasion you need a replacement key, the following options can assist you discover the closest and most effective provider:
1. Local Automotive Locksmiths
Automotive locksmiths concentrate on key replacement and can replicate most kinds of keys. They are typically more inexpensive than car dealerships and offer quicker service.
2. Car Dealerships
While frequently more expensive, dealerships supply replacement keys particular to your vehicle's make and design. They also use programs services for transponder and clever keys.
3. Hardware Stores
Many hardware stores can replicate traditional keys, but their capability to handle advanced keys like transponders and fob remotes is limited.
4. Mobile Locksmiths
Mobile locksmiths can concern your location, making it practical, especially in the case of a lockout. They typically bring the necessary equipment to develop and configure replacement keys.
5. Key Replacement Services
There are businesses committed to key replacement that can assist you find the best key and ensure it is programmed effectively. They might also provide a warranty or assurance on their services.

Just how much does it cost to replace a car key?
Expenses can vary considerably depending upon the type of key. Traditional keys might cost around ₤ 5, while transponder keys can v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 500, specifically if shows is needed.
2. Can I get a car key made without the original?
Yes, however it may be more complex. A locksmith or dealer may be able to produce a key based on the VIN or other vehicle data.
3. The length of time does it require to get a replacement key?
Timing depends upon the key type and the provider chosen. Conventional keys can often be duplicated within minutes, while transponder and smart keys might take a number of hours.
4. Can I program my own transponder key?
While some devices permit DIY programs, it is often suggested to have a professional manage programming to ensure compatibility with your vehicle.
5. What if my car key is lost or stolen?
If your car key is lost or stolen, it's sensible to change the locks or the ignition system to prevent unapproved access, particularly if your vehicle is high-end or holds significant personal value.
